Frequently Asked Questions About Methadone Clinics in Lake Havasu City

Are there any methadone clinics or addiction rehabs in Lake Havasu City?

There may be addiction rehabs or methadone clinics in Lake Havasu City that provide treatment for individuals with opioid addiction. These treatment centers may offer medication-assisted treatment using methadone, counseling, and support services to help individuals on their path to recovery.

How do I find reputable methadone treatment in Lake Havasu City?

To find a reputable methadone treatment facility in Lake Havasu City, you can search online for local clinics, read reviews from patients, and consult with medical professionals or addiction specialists. It's important to choose a clinic that is licensed, accredited, and has a positive track record in providing effective addiction treatment.

What services are offered by methadone clinics and rehabs in Lake Havasu City?

Methadone treatment centers and clinics in Lake Havasu City may offer a range of services, including methadone maintenance treatment, medical assessments, individual and group counseling, behavioral therapies, and educational programs. Such clinics typically aim to provide comprehensive care to address the physical and psychological aspects of addiction recovery.

Can I use insurance to cover methadone treatment in Lake Havasu City?

Some methadone clinics in Lake Havasu City may accept insurance to help cover the cost of treatment. It's important to check with both the clinic and your insurance provider to verify coverage details, including co-pays, deductibles, and any limitations on the number of sessions or medication doses covered.

What is the process of admission to a methadone treatment center in Lake Havasu City?

The process of admission to a methadone treatment center in Lake Havasu City may involve an initial assessment by medical professionals. This assessment helps determine the appropriate treatment plan, including methadone dosage. You may also need to provide medical history, undergo urine tests, and attend orientation sessions to understand the clinic's policies and procedures.

How long does methadone treatment at Lake Havasu City clinics usually last?

The duration of methadone treatment at Lake Havasu City clinics and rehab centers can vary based on individual needs and treatment goals. Some people may remain on methadone maintenance for an extended period, while others may gradually reduce their dosage over time. The treatment plan is typically tailored to each patient's progress and recovery journey.

Do Lake Havasu City methadone clinics offer additional support services?

Some methadone rehabs in Lake Havasu City may offer additional support services to complement medication-assisted treatment. These services may include counseling, therapy sessions, support groups, and educational workshops. The goal is to provide a comprehensive approach to recovery that addresses both the physical and emotional aspects of addiction.

Can I transfer my methadone treatment from another city to Lake Havasu City?

It may be possible to transfer your methadone treatment from another city to an Lake Havasu City clinic or treatment facility, provided the center is willing to accept the transfer and you meet their admission criteria. It's recommended to contact the Lake Havasu City clinic in advance to discuss the process and any documentation or information required for the transfer.
